About Minnie
Meet the beautiful Minnie, queen of comfort, cuddles, and cheeky charm.
Minnie is a seven year old French bulldog who weighs in at a delightful 10.5 kilograms and stands proud at 31cm tall, making her the perfect compact companion.
Minnie's came into care as a private surrender, through no fault of her own and is now looking for a loving home where she can truly shine as the one and only dog in your life.
Minnie is children friendly, and as she's your typical Frenchie she will love to snuggle with them, get pats and from time to time climb over them as well as bump them with her butt.
While Minnie has lived with other dogs in the past, Minnie much prefers the spotlight all to herself and can become reactive when sharing her space, so she’s best suited to a home where she can rule the roost solo (so please note no other dogs in the home)
Minnie is untested with cats, although since she's quite the Diva and prefers her humans to all to herself, we will air on the side of caution and say a big No to cats or pocket pets.
Minnie is toilet trained and happily uses a doggy door like the proud Diva she is.
While Minnie's never been crate trained, she’s a smart little cookie and could easily adjust to new routines if needed.
Minnie enjoys a daily stroll, happily walking up to 4-5 kilometers a day, (temperatures permitting) although she does like to set her own pace and can pull on the lead, especially when other dogs are around - definitely not dog parks and catch ups for this little potato!
Minnie's not a fan of canine chit-chat and prefers her walks without the company of other dogs around (antisocial around other dogs being walked)
This little lady has average energy levels, and while she loves getting out and about, she’s equally content curled up beside you, enjoying all the love and attention she can get.
Minnie is quiet and doesn't bark unnecessarily, which makes her a peaceful presence in the home.
Her favorite place in the house is right next to her human, and her ultimate idea of bliss is playing a game of fetch followed by a good cuddle session.
Minnie is motivated by toys and affection, and her greatest joy is simply being close to you.
Minnie is your true Velcro-dog with a big heart and an even bigger personality.
Minnie's ideal home would be a calm, stable, and full of love with someone who understands her need for space when it comes to other animals, to let Minnie live her best Diva life as your one and only.

Adoption details
Paw Prints Canine Rescue is a non for profit dog rescue located in Southeast Queensland.
All our dogs leave our care with full vet work (up-to-date vaccinated, microchipped, desexed, heart worm and intestinal wormed and flea treated).
Please note - They will not leave for their new homes until they are 12 weeks of age and have been desexed, micro-chipped and vaccinated up to date.
Please note - we are not a pound or have kennels - all our dogs stay in foster carers homes and therefore dogs are not able to be simply viewed - only approved applicants will meet the dogs.

Once an adoption enquiry is completed our admin team will assess the application and if successful we will arrange for a meet and greet to be completed. We may also request photos of your yard for consideration of your application. Please note that we will do no more than 3 meet and greets per dog.
Approved applicants will be contacted to arrange a time for a meet & greet via email. You must bring your current dog along to the meeting if you are meeting another dog/puppy, this is to ensure they get along before commencing adoption - proof of your dogs up-to-date vaccination is required before any meet and greet is arranged.
Our adoption fee must be cleared in our bank account before any animal is available for pick up. Please note we bank with ANZ - any other bank may take 48 hours to process the monies.
Paw Prints Canine Rescue has a 10 day trial period – this basically means that if for any reason the adoption does not work out and the dog needs to be returned to us, the adoption fee minus an admin fee (minimum is $250) will be returned to the adoptees via bank transfer within 7 working days.
Please note that if an interstate adoption needs to be returned or regional adoption all transport cost with be paid by the adopter.
Please also note while this can be a very exciting time for everyone, it can also be an overwhelming time for dogs and we ask that you do try and allow your new family member to settle in their new home and adjust
INTERSTATE ADOPTIONS **
Any transport costs are to be paid by the adopting family, however we can assist you in helping with transport to airports etc.
** Please note some of our dogs are not available for interstate adoption - each bio will state if available for adoption - please check before applying.
AFTER THE TRIAL PERIOD
After the 10 day trial period is completed Paw Prints Canine will send out all relevant paperwork for your new furbaby via email including the transfer of microchip form.
